Can Herbal Extracts be used in body lotions?

Herbal extracts have a long – standing history of use in traditional medicine and skincare. Ancient civilizations such as the Egyptians, Greeks, and Chinese recognized the therapeutic properties of plants and used them to treat various skin conditions and enhance beauty. For example, aloe vera, a well – known herbal extract, has been used for centuries to soothe sunburns, moisturize the skin, and promote healing. Its gel contains polysaccharides, amino acids, and vitamins that have anti – inflammatory and moisturizing effects.

Another benefit is the wide range of active compounds present in herbal extracts. Different plants contain various bioactive substances such as antioxidants, anti – inflammatory agents, and antimicrobial compounds. For instance, green tea extract is rich in catechins, which are powerful antioxidants. These antioxidants can help protect the skin from free radical damage, which is one of the main causes of premature aging. They can also reduce inflammation in the skin, making it suitable for people with sensitive or acne – prone skin.

Rosemary extract is another example. It has antibacterial and anti – inflammatory properties. When added to body lotions, it can help prevent skin infections and reduce redness and swelling. Additionally, rosemary extract has a pleasant aroma, which can enhance the sensory experience of using the body lotion.

However, using herbal extracts in body lotions also comes with some challenges. One of the main issues is standardization. Unlike synthetic ingredients, herbal extracts can vary in their composition depending on factors such as the plant species, growing conditions, and extraction methods. This variability can make it difficult to ensure consistent quality and efficacy in body lotions. For example, if an extract is obtained from a plant grown in different regions or at different times of the year, the concentration of active compounds may differ. This can lead to inconsistent results in terms of the lotion’s performance.

Another challenge is stability. Herbal extracts are often more prone to degradation compared to synthetic ingredients. They can be affected by factors such as light, heat, and oxygen. For example, some herbal extracts may lose their potency when exposed to sunlight or high temperatures for an extended period. This means that special storage and formulation techniques are required to maintain the stability of the extracts in body lotions.

When formulating body lotions with herbal extracts, it’s important to consider the compatibility of the extracts with other ingredients in the lotion. Some herbal extracts may interact with other components, such as emulsifiers or preservatives, which can affect the stability and performance of the lotion. For example, certain extracts may cause the lotion to separate or change its texture. Therefore, it’s crucial to conduct compatibility tests during the formulation process.
